Hey Marit,

Handing over the ContrastCheck audit work before I'm out next week. Quick status: the automated sweep of the Lumenfield dashboard flagged 34 components below the 4.5:1 ratio, and I've fixed 20. The remaining ones are mostly chart legends and disabled-state buttons — trickier because the design tokens are shared. If the nightly audit job pages you, it's almost always a flaky screenshot diff; just rerun it. The full findings list and token mapping notes are on the wiki here.

dashboard of tawef-hagug = https://superset.norvadyn.local/display/projects/build/ticket/build/spaces/ticket/1e989f0e6c200d20fc4ae06b

MEMO — To the Board

Re: Term sheet from Kestrel Fabrication.

Kestrel has proposed a three-year supply partnership covering the Orvale component line: volume commitments, a 12% price lock, and co-exclusivity in the Darrowfield market. Counsel flags the termination clause as one-sided. Management recommends countering on exclusivity and renewal terms before the next board call. The confidential planning note follows below.

confidential, kagep-kahof: Druokax Systems plans to lower the Ulaath list price by 53 percent in March.

**Q: Why does the Lanternway prefetcher keep downloading tiles the user never looks at?**

A: That's mostly by design — it grabs a ring of tiles around the viewport plus the predicted pan direction. If a customer complains about data usage, check whether "aggressive mode" got enabled; it prefetches two zoom levels and can chew through mobile data quickly. Toggle it off in device settings and the cache will settle down within a session. If usage stays high after that, escalate to the tiles team at the address below.

escalation mailbox, bafog-fafog: ulador@paliqlabs.internal

// MAX_WATERING_WINDOW_MIN sets the hard ceiling on a single watering
// cycle for DripPilot hubs. Support: if a customer reports pumps running
// past this limit, it's almost always a stuck flow sensor, not this
// constant — do not advise raising it. Values above 45 risk reservoir
// overdraw on the smaller Terrace-series units and will void the moisture
// calibration. Any change requires sign-off from the firmware team and a
// recalibration pass. The build this value ships in is identified by the
// token below.

session token of tajef-bageg = htk21_5d90d574934f3ccae6437